Former Walt's Restaurant On Bonny Oaks Drive Suffers Extensive Fire Damage

  • Saturday, October 5, 2019
photo by Chattanooga Fire Department

Chattanooga Fire Department crews on Saturday extinguished a fire at a vacant building on Bonny Oaks Drive. 


Units were called to the structure in the 6000 block around 4:45 p.m. The building used to be Walt’s Restaurant and then AJ’s. 


CFD arrived on scene and found heavy smoke coming from the front side of the building. 

 

Firefighters made an aggressive offensive attack from three sides. But heavy winds were causing smoke to blow back across Bonny Oaks so everyone pulled back and went to a defensive attack.

They made a good stop on the structure to keep the whole building from burning.


An adjacent building was untouched. 

 

One firefighter suffered a heat-related injury on the scene and was transported to the hospital. 

 

The vacant structure suffered extensive damage in the fire, which is under investigation. 

 

Twelve companies responded to the scene. Extra companies were brought to add to manpower due to the heat so crews could swap out. 

 

Mutual aid was helping provide fire coverage in the city. 


Bonny Oaks Drive was initially shut down for emergency crews. 


Hot spots were being monitored.
